Requirements
  • A bachelor's degree in Engineering, Quality, Business, or a related field is preferred.
  • Five to ten years of quality leadership experience within a manufacturing environment is required.
  • Supervisory or people leadership experience is required.
  • Strong knowledge of Quality Management Systems, Statistical Process Control, Corrective and Preventive Action, root cause analysis, and continuous improvement methodologies is required.
  • Experience with ISO quality standards and regulatory compliance is required.
  • Strong analytical, communication, and leadership skills are required.
  • The ability to influence cross-functional teams and drive organizational change is required.
Responsibilities
  • Lead, coach, and develop the site Quality organization.
  • Establish and execute the site's quality strategy aligned with business objectives.
  • Foster a culture of accountability, customer focus, and continuous improvement.
  • Lead cross-functional quality initiatives that improve operational performance.
  • Maintain and continuously improve the site's Quality Management System.
  • Ensure compliance with customer, regulatory, and industry requirements.
  • Lead customer, internal, and third-party audits.
  • Develop and maintain quality policies, procedures, and documentation.
  • Monitor and report key quality metrics, including customer complaints, defects, scrap, and Cost of Poor Quality.
  • Lead root cause investigations and Corrective and Preventive Action activities.
  • Drive Lean Six Sigma and contin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Utilize statistical tools and data analysis to improve process capability.
  • Serve as the primary quality contact for customers.
  • Lead customer issue resolution and corrective action activities.
  • Partner with Operations and Engineering to improve product and process performance.
  • Build strong relationships with customers while maintaining a high level of responsiveness.
  • Plan and execute internal quality audits.
  • Coordinate customer and third-party audits.
  • Ensure timely closure of audit findings and corrective actions.
  • Promote best practices across the organization.
  • Provide quality-related training and coaching throughout the organization.
  • Mentor employees in problem-solving methodologies and quality systems.
  • Promote continuous learning and knowledge sharing across departments.
Desired Qualifications
  • Experience with Minitab, Microsoft Office, and ERP/MRP systems is preferred.
  • Lean Six Sigma Black Belt is preferred.
  • ASQ certifications such as Certified Quality Engineer, Certified Quality Auditor, or Certified Quality Manager are preferred.
  • Experience with ISO 9001, ISO 13485, ISO 17025, AS9100, or similar quality standards is preferred.
  • Manufacturing experience within advanced materials, plastics, polymers, or medical products is preferred.

MCGC supplies chemicals and advanced materials globally, including high-performance polymers, industrial gases (Nippon Sanso), and pharmaceuticals (Mitsubishi Tanabe Pharma), serving industries like automotive, semiconductor, aerospace, and healthcare. Its products rely on advanced chemical engineering and material science to create materials for electronics, mobility, and health, including carbon fiber composites, specialty polymers, and recyclable plastics. It differentiates itself with a massive global manufacturing footprint, deep technical expertise across chemicals, materials, and life sciences, and active open-innovation through Diamond Edge Ventures that integrates biotech and clean-tech startups into its ecosystem. The company aims to lead sustainable chemistry and advanced materials while pursuing net-zero emissions by 2050 and advancing a circular economy through decarbonization and scalable recycling.

Psiquantum, Mitsubishi Ufj Financial Group And Mitsubishi Chemical Announce Partnership To Design Energy-Efficient Materials On Psiquantum’S Fault-Tolerant Quantum Computer

PALO ALTO,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--PsiQuantum and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group today announced that they are beginning work with Mitsubishi Chemical Group on a joint project to simulate excited states of photochromic molecules which have widespread industrial and residential potential applications such as the development of smart windows, energy-efficient data storage, solar energy storage and solar cells, and other photoswitching use cases. Qlimate, a PsiQuantum-led initiative that includes MUFG as a partner, focuses on using fault-tolerant quantum computing to crack the most challenging computational problems and accelerate the development of scalable breakthroughs across climate technologies, including more energy-efficient materials.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group (MUFG) is committed to supporting the world’s transition to a sustainable future, and to encourage industry access to the most promising breakthrough technologies. By pioneering PsiQuantum’s Qlimate solutions with industry leader Mitsubishi Chemical, MUFG is at the forefront of quantum computing for sustainability

The Mitsubishi Chemical Group Embarks on Strategic Acquisition of CPC, Leading Italian Manufacturer of Carbon Fiber Composite Components to the Automotive Industry | asiantex.net

The Mitsubishi Chemical Group (MCG Group) is proud to announce it has attained full ownership of CPC SRL (CPC), a renowned Italian company specializing in the manufacturing and distribution of automobile components crafted from carbon fiber reinforced plastic (CFRP). This pivotal acquisition that began with minority ownership in 2017 aligns with MCG Group’s long-term strategic vision to further expand and enhance its vertically integrated carbon fiber supply chain. The transaction, subject to regulatory approvals, is expected to close in late 2023.
